4-Methoxyindoline hydrochloride, a versatile chemical compound, serves as a valuable reagent in organic and medicinal chemistry. Its application in chemical synthesis is well-recognized, particularly in the development of pharmaceuticals and novel organic molecules. By serving as a key intermediate in various reactions, 4-Methoxyindoline hydrochloride facilitates the creation of complex molecular structures with precision and efficiency. Its unique properties contribute significantly to the synthesis of biologically active compounds, enabling researchers to explore new avenues in drug discovery and material science. When used judiciously in synthesis processes, this compound offers a wide range of possibilities for designing innovative molecules with specific functions and applications.
